Johnson-Iorio Memorial Park is a hidden gem in Highland, New York, perfect for visitors looking to unwind and connect with nature. Spanning several acres, the park features expansive green fields, shaded picnic areas, and well-maintained walking paths that meander through a landscape of towering trees and vibrant flora. It’s an ideal spot for a leisurely afternoon, whether you're indulging in a quiet picnic, enjoying a book under a tree, or engaging in outdoor games with family and friends. The park is designed to cater to all ages, providing playgrounds for children and open spaces for recreational activities. In addition to its natural beauty, the park often hosts community events and gatherings, enhancing its role as a social hub for locals and tourists alike. As you stroll through the park, take a moment to appreciate the memorials and sculptures that honor the area's history and heritage. For those who enjoy photography, the picturesque settings offer numerous opportunities to capture the essence of this tranquil location. Whether you're visiting Highland for a day or planning a longer stay, Johnson-Iorio Memorial Park is a must-see attraction that offers a refreshing escape from the hustle and bustle of everyday life. The park remains open year-round, inviting you to experience its beauty in every season, from the blooming flowers of spring to the vibrant foliage of autumn.
